WWII Wales workshop brings WWII history to life through hands on, fun activities and talks! We start with a talk on themes such as the Blitz, evacuees, rationing, the blackout, and much more, all whilst showing and passing around items from the era! This also includes 2 activities, a Blitz simulation, and a blackout game!
Our second half includes dressing up in WWII uniforms, as well as getting to look and hold even more artefacts. We also include replica riffles to hold! To finish, learn more and ask as many questions as you like with our Q and A!

What size groups do we cater for?
1 classroom at a time, no more than 35.
How does safeguarding work for online workshops?
All workshops are done by myself, the owner of World War Wales Workshop. DBS checked. No workshop is recorded, and schools will be asked in advance to sign a document stating that pictures are allowed to be taken.
What technology/devices/type of internet connection do schools need for an online workshop?
Our Online Workshops are done through Skype, or if needed, we can arrange a call through Zoom. Each session lasts either 1 hour, 2 hours, or all day, depending on which sessions the class teacher has chosen (Please visit our website to read more about the sessions we offer)
